A Poem by Edward Martin

Sickness from the inside

Manifests in actions and thoughts

Acted upon

without heeding

Intuition

Ramifications

and respect

Gained and lost

Self involved self worth

Less at each juncture.

No one cares anymore,

They’ve come to expect so little from you

You’re just a fragmented thinker

Thinking you’re going up,

You’re coming down.

Thinking you’re blending in,

You’re sticking out.

Why is it you are the only one who knows

Just how worthless you truly are.

Sticking out like a sore thumb.

You’ll get a ride but not where you want.
